When to replace duct cleaning

HVAC

The answer to 'when to replace duct cleaning' is that most experts recommend having your air ducts professionally cleaned every 3-5 years, depending on several factors. Duct cleaning is an important maintenance task that helps improve indoor air quality, energy efficiency, and the lifespan of your HVAC system.

The frequency of duct cleaning can vary based on factors like the age of your home, whether you have pets, if anyone in your home has allergies or asthma, and how often the HVAC system is used. Homes with more occupants, pets, or heavy HVAC usage may need more frequent duct cleaning, perhaps every 2-3 years. Older homes or those with significant dust buildup may also require more frequent cleaning.

Frequently Asked Questions

How do I know if my air ducts need cleaning?

Signs your air ducts may need cleaning include visible dust or debris, musty odors, and reduced airflow from vents. Scheduling a professional inspection is the best way to determine if cleaning is needed.

Can I clean my air ducts myself?

While some basic duct maintenance can be done DIY, it's generally recommended to have air ducts professionally cleaned. Professional technicians have the right equipment and expertise to thoroughly clean the entire duct system.
